Course Content

• Introduction to Nanotechnology and its Energy Applications
• Nanotechnology for Renewable Energy: Solar, Wind, and Geothermal Technologies
• Nanomaterials in Energy Storage: Batteries, Fuel Cells, and Supercapacitors
• Nanotechnology for Energy Efficiency: Building Materials and Industrial Processes
• Intellectual Property Rights in Nanotechnology for Energy
• Environmental Law and Regulations concerning Nanomaterials in Energy
• Energy Law and Policy Frameworks for Nanotechnology Innovation
• Liability and Risk Assessment in Nanotechnology for Energy Applications
• Commercialization and Investment in Nanotechnology Energy Technologies
